    From Decoration to Design: Materializing Hidden Symbolism in Historical Architecture

    a. How recurring motifs in historical art infiltrate architectural ornamentation
    Historical architecture often repurposes artistic motifs—such as the Egyptian lotus, Greco-Roman acanthus, or Islamic geometric patterns—translating them from wall reliefs and frescoes into carved stone, stained glass, and façade detailing. For example, the lotus motif, revered in ancient Egyptian art as a symbol of rebirth, appears in the ornamented columns of the Hypostyle Hall at Karnak, later echoed in the intricate stonework of Southeast Asian temples, where its spiritual resonance persists even in modern interpretations.

    b. Case studies of symbolic motifs reinterpreted through structural elements
    The acanthus leaf, central to classical Greek and Roman decorative arts, became a structural signature in Corinthian capitals and cathedral portals. In the Florence Baptistery’s west doors, designer Lorenzo Ghiberti transformed a two-dimensional motif into a three-dimensional narrative framework, where each leaf’s curve supports both aesthetic harmony and spiritual symbolism. Similarly, the arabesque patterns of Andalusian architecture, originally ornamental stucco carvings, have inspired contemporary façade systems that blend cultural continuity with energy-efficient shading.

    c. The cognitive shift from aesthetic appreciation to functional integration
    Rather than static decoration, these motifs embody a cognitive evolution: what was once symbolic embellishment becomes integral to spatial identity and structural logic. This shift reflects a deeper human tendency to layer meaning—where form and function converge, enabling buildings to tell layered stories across centuries.

    From Pattern Recognition to Spatial Narrative: Reading History Through Form

    a. Tracing narrative continuity between artistic motifs and architectural layouts
    Artistic motifs carry embedded narratives—mythological scenes, religious allegories, or political statements—that architects recontextualize spatially. The use of the labyrinth motif in medieval cathedrals, for instance, mirrors the intricate floor patterns found in Persian carpets, guiding pilgrims through a physical journey that echoes spiritual transformation. This continuity invites users to experience architecture as a narrative, where every repeated form deepens meaning.

    b. The role of recurring forms in shaping user experience across time
    Repeating patterns create rhythm and familiarity, enhancing spatial orientation and emotional resonance. In Japanese tea houses, the recurrence of tatami grid patterns and shoji screen rhythms harmonizes with ritual movement, fostering mindfulness. Modern architects like Tadao Ando echo this through minimalist repetition—repeating concrete planes and light wells—that echoes both Zen simplicity and historical spatial sequencing, reinforcing continuity between past and present.

    c. Cognitive mapping of historical continuity in built environments
    Studies in environmental psychology reveal that humans subconsciously map spatial patterns to cultural memory. A 2022 survey of visitors to Barcelona’s Sagrada Família found that 68% associated the repeated branching columns with natural forms, intuitively linking them to trees and light—echoing Antoni Gaudí’s intention to “read nature through architecture.” This cognitive anchoring validates how historical forms become living memory in urban fabric.

    From Inspired Form to Adaptive Reuse: Repurposing Historical Patterns in Contemporary Practice

    a. Strategies for translating historical motifs into sustainable design solutions
    Contemporary architects increasingly mine historical patterns for sustainable innovation. The revival of traditional Persian wind towers (badgirs), originally designed to channel cool air through geometric lattice screens, now informs passive cooling systems in green buildings. Similarly, the rhythmic arches of Moorish architecture are reinterpreted using recycled materials and parametric modeling, preserving cultural identity while reducing environmental impact.

    b. Challenges and opportunities in balancing authenticity with modern needs
    Adapting historical forms demands sensitivity to context and function. While replicating Gothic tracery in modern facades can evoke grandeur, unchecked ornamentation risks aesthetic dissonance. Successful projects—like the Louvre Abu Dhabi’s dome, whose star-patterned lattice filters light using computational geometry—demonstrate how cultural motifs, when algorithmically refined, bridge heritage and innovation without compromise.

    c. How pattern continuity supports cultural identity in redevelopment
    In post-industrial redevelopment, preserving and evolving local patterns reinforces community identity. The adaptive reuse of Warsaw’s Old Town, where historic brickwork and ornamental details were meticulously restored and reinserted into modern housing, shows how pattern continuity fosters belonging. Research from UNESCO confirms that communities with preserved visual heritage report 40% higher social cohesion, underscoring patterns as vital threads in cultural resilience.

    2. The Foundations of Modern Fishing Technology

    a. Early innovations: from simple nets to mechanical reels

    Ancient fishers used basic tools like nets, spears, and fishing rods made from wood or bone. The invention of the mechanical reel in the 17th century revolutionized fishing by allowing anglers to cast farther and retrieve lines more efficiently, dramatically increasing catch success rates. These technological steps laid the groundwork for modern fishing gear.

    b. The advent of marine navigation tools: from compasses to GPS

    Navigation has been critical for offshore fishing. Early mariners relied on celestial navigation, then compasses and soundings. The introduction of GPS in the late 20th century transformed this landscape, enabling precise positioning over vast ocean expanses. This advancement reduced search times, improved safety, and enhanced sustainable practices by avoiding overfished areas.

    c. How technology transformed fishing efficiency and sustainability

    Modern innovations like automatic trolling systems, satellite data, and real-time weather updates have increased fishing yields while minimizing ecological impact. These tools help fishers target specific species, reduce bycatch, and comply with regulations—pivotal for balancing industry needs and environmental conservation.

    3. Understanding Fish Behavior and Migration Patterns

    a. Biological insights: fish instincts and environmental cues

    Fish behavior is influenced by environmental factors such as water temperature, salinity, and lunar cycles. For example, many species spawn during specific moon phases, and their feeding patterns align with daylight cycles. Understanding these cues allows fishers to optimize their efforts and avoid overexploitation.

    b. The significance of migration distances, exemplified by bluefin tuna

    Bluefin tuna undertake remarkable migrations across thousands of kilometers between feeding and spawning grounds. Tracking these migrations provides insights into ecological health and guides sustainable fishing quotas, exemplifying how understanding fish movement patterns is vital for conservation.

    c. How technological tracking has deepened knowledge of fish movements

    Satellite tags, acoustic telemetry, and data analytics have revolutionized our understanding of fish migration. For instance, studies on Atlantic salmon revealed complex routes and behaviors previously unknown, informing management policies and helping prevent stock depletion.

    4. The Role of Technology in Recreational Fishing

    a. From traditional methods to digital fish finders

    Traditional anglers relied on experience, visual cues, and basic equipment. Today, digital fish finders utilize sonar technology to detect fish underwater, providing real-time images of underwater structures and fish schools. This advancement has made recreational fishing more accessible and successful for enthusiasts of all levels.

    b. The integration of GPS and sonar in modern fishing practices

    Combining GPS with sonar devices allows anglers to mark productive fishing spots, track their routes, and return to successful locations effortlessly. This integration enhances efficiency and encourages responsible fishing by enabling better area management.
